This position serves as the Program Manager of the Violent Crime Information Center (VCIC) which consists of a wide range of complex and diverse statewide program components that provide critical law enforcement and public services in highly sensitive and visible subject areas. These components consist of: the California Sex Offender Registry and the Investigative Services Program. The SSM III oversees and sets policies pertaining to programs that perform legislatively mandated functions relating to the identification and apprehension of persons responsible for specific violent crimes and for the disappearance and exploitation of persons, especially children.
